Aren’t these bunnies adorable?! They are made with Nutter Butter cookies – my favorite. These are very easy to make; simply dip the Nutter Butters into some melted almond bark and decorate. I used large marshmallows for the ears and rolled the cut side in some pink sanding sugar. The nose is a heart sprinkle that I bought at Wal-Mart. Finally, I used an edible marker to draw on the bunny face. Look for edible markers in the cake decorating section at Michael’s or Hobby Lobby. This is a great Easter activity for the kids!
Nutter Bunnies
(Printable Recipe)
- 1 pack Nutter Butter cookies
- 1 (24oz) package vanilla almond bark
- large marshmallows
- pink sanding sugar
- sprinkles
- edible marker
Cut marshmallows in half to make 2 rounds. Cut each round in half and dip the cut side (sticky side) into pink sanding sugar. Set aside.
Roll out a large piece of wax paper to place the dipped cookies on. Melt almond bark according to the package directions. Dip 6 Nutter Butters in the almond bark, shake off excess almond bark. Place on wax paper and attach ears. Using tweezers, place nose sprinkle on the cookie.
Repeat with remaining Nutter Butters. Allow to set up completely (about 30 minutes to an hour). Draw face on bunny with edible marker and enjoy.
